[cairo] Breakage on Solaris 9

Geyer, Nikolas nikolas.geyer at cybertrust.com
Mon May 8 23:41:30 PDT 2006

Hi Everyone,

Just wondering if someone can assist in compiling cairo-1.0.2 on Solaris
9 (sparc) machine. The machine itself is a Sun Fire V240 and output of
uname is 'SunOS blah 5.9 Generic_118558-10 sun4u sparc
SUNW,Sun-Fire-V240. GCC is version 3.4.2 using thread model posix. 

Below is an output of the errors its coming up with when compiling...

cairo-font.c: In function `_cairo_toy_font_face_scaled_font_create':
cairo-font.c:405: error: `CAIRO_SCALED_FONT_BACKEND_DEFAULT' undeclared
(first use in this function)
cairo-font.c:405: error: (Each undeclared identifier is reported only
cairo-font.c:405: error: for each function it appears in.)
cairo-font.c: At top level:
cairo-font.c:430: error: `CAIRO_SCALED_FONT_BACKEND_DEFAULT' undeclared
here (not in a function)
cairo-font.c:430: error: initializer element is not constant
cairo-font.c:430: error: (near initialization for
cairo-font.c:1316: warning: visibility attribute not supported in this
configuration; ignored
make[2]: *** [cairo-font.lo] Error 1
make[2]: Leaving directory `/export/home/operations/cairo-1.0.2/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/export/home/operations/cairo-1.0.2'
make: *** [all] Error 2

Any help would be appreciated. Cheers.

Nikolas Geyer
Security Administrator
Cybertrust Pty Ltd
3rd Floor, 243 Northbourne Ave, Lyneham ACT, 2602
p: 612 6268 9210
e: nikolas.geyer at cybertrust.com
w: www.cybertrust.com

